Transaction 49e0cd763e66469c2c3a28ffd99f4ed64eb91c4571a42e17a9c82843f95bb505

2 Input
1 Outputs
  • 49e0cd763e66469c2c3a28ffd99f4ed64eb91c4571a42e17a9c82843f95bb505:0
  • value  2080262
    address  34bvgHFr6cCpqxstEKnpW5Jx8aqH43xBZp